What is Double Glazing?

Double glazing describes a window style that consists of 2 panes (or sheets) of glass separated by a space filled with gas (typically argon) or a vacuum. This style creates an insulating barrier that lowers heat loss, decreases condensation, and lowers energy bills.

Typical Issues with Double Glazing

Despite its advantages, double glazing is not unsusceptible to problems. Some common issues include:

  1. Foggy or Cloudy Windows: Often arising from a broken seal, moisture can enter the space between panes, causing condensation.
  2. Broken or Cracked Glass: Impact or extreme weather can lead to breaks or fractures in the glass.
  3. Degrading Seals or Frames: Over time, the seals can degrade, and frames may require repair or replacement due to rot or damage.
  4. Functional Failures: Over time, windows might not open or close properly due to problems with hinges, locks, or the frame.

The Double Glazing Repair Process

The repair work process will differ depending on the issue at hand. Below are some general actions that specialists generally follow when repairing double glazing:

  1. Initial Inspection: A thorough evaluation of the windows to identify issues.
  2. Seal Replacement: In cases of foggy windows, the damaged seals are removed and changed.
  3. Glass Replacement: If the glass is split or broken, it is thoroughly eliminated, and brand-new glass is set up.
  4. Frame Repairs: Damaged frames might require support or replacement to ensure structural stability.
  5. Last Inspection: A thorough re-inspection to ensure the work has been finished adequately and that the window operates effectively.
